According to HHS Inspector General Daniel R. Levinson, Congress should focus on enrollment if it wants to cut down on Medicare fraud. However, in testimony presented to the Senate Special Committee on Aging, which held a May 6 hearing on fraud in government health programs, he also said excessive reimbursement for HME items is an issue. Aligning Medicare reimbursement with the market would "make DME fraud less attractive," Levinson said.
